How to Prevent Basement Floods and Water Damage?

The best way to handle basement flooding is to prevent it from happening in the first place. Here are some simple steps:

Do Not Forget Your Gutters and Downspouts: Clean out the gutters and downspouts and make sure they are clear of leaves. This allows movement of water away from your house, and it does not seep down to the basement. Downspouts should be extended away from the foundation.

Mend Cracks and openings: Check your basement floors and walls to see whether there are any cracks. Plug such openings with waterproof sealant. This does not allow the sneaking in of water when it is raining heavily.

Install a Sump Pump: A sump pump is a tiny gadget that drains water out of your basement. It is wise to invest in flood protection when residing in a flood-prone region. Get it inspected regularly to ensure that it is functional.

Improve Drainage Around Your House: Make sure the ground slopes away from your foundation. This helps water flow away from your house instead of pooling around it.

What to Do When Your Basement Floods?

The flood in the basement still may occur, even when you are as careful as possible. In case you have floods in your basement:

Be Safe: If the water is high, then turn off the electricity. Always avoid wading through flooded water, which may contain dangers or may be polluted.

Call a Water Damage Service: Reach trusted restoration companies at once. They possess the machinery and skills to deal with the flood damage properly.

Record the Damage: Take photos of the flood in the basement to make an insurance claim. This is useful in making claims of repairs or reimbursement.
